Want to actually build something? GT Tools is hiring a Part-Time Manufacturing Optimization Specialist for approximately 20 hours/week . We're looking for someone studying Manufacturing, Mechanical, Industrial Engineering-or another technically relevant field-who wants experience that goes well beyond a traditional internship. You'll work directly with our manufacturing team on: CNC machining
- CAD/CAM
- Lean
- manufacturing data
- 3D printing
- G-code/Python
- process optimization
- quality systems
- automation More importantly, you'll be given actual manufacturing problems and the opportunity to develop solutions that get implemented on our shop floor.
We're looking for someone who's exceptionally comfortable with technology, curious, analytical, willing to get their hands dirty, and constantly looking for a better way to do things. The position is on-site in Durango, CO , approximately 20 hours/week , with flexibility around a college schedule. For the right person, we see this as much more than a semester job. As GT Tools grows, there's an opportunity for the scope and responsibility of this role to grow with it.
